When it comes to hiring a DJ for your event, it’s important to ask the right questions to ensure that you are getting the best professional for the job. Whether it’s a wedding, corporate event, or private party, asking the following questions will help you make an informed decision and ensure that your event is a success.
First and foremost, it’s important to ask the DJ about their experience. How long have they been in the industry? Have they worked at similar events before? Requesting references or a portfolio of their past work can also give you an idea of their style and expertise. Additionally, ask about any specific genres or types of events they specialize in to ensure that their style aligns with your vision.
Another crucial aspect to consider is the DJ’s equipment. Do they have their own sound system and lighting setup? Are they familiar with the venue’s setup, or will they need additional equipment? It’s essential to discuss these technical details to avoid any last-minute surprises on the day of the event.
